Daybreak Maintenance: Monday, April 27, 2015

All games can expect a three to five hour downtime Monday morning.

Daybreak Games will perform a general maintenance beginning at 7:00AM PDT on Monday, April 27th. The current estimated downtime for this maintenance is three to five hours, depending on the service.

This maintenance may impact the following Daybreak services across all games:

  • Commerce functions, including purchases, for all games
  • Game logins
  • Web logins for all Daybreak sites, including account creation
  • Forum access (login, posting, and viewing abilities) for all Daybreak games.

I will be specific, the Mercs on EQ (specifically the Damage Caters as well as the Melee Damage mercs) are constantly switching stances to passive, therefore they are useless while in combat. Even when I reset them to my desired stance, they behave as they normally do in passive mode.

As a temporary fix until they can actually patch, try this. Open the Mercenary Management window. Click on the word "Stance" to re-arrange the stance order. Set the stance you want to use.
